Mayor Teresi indicated that the Village of Golden Valley has no formal
objection to the apartment complex being constructed at Natchez Avenue
and Cedar Lake Road in St . Louis Park ; however , there is a concern for
traffic circulation in the area .
After considerable discussion of traffic problems and alternatives for
the area , it was decided that the staff of both municipalities should
set up a meeting with the mayors of the two communities , the representative
from the County Highway Department , representatives from Prudential
InsuranCe Company to discuss possible right - of -way locations for the
extension of Cedar Lake Road to France Avenue (Phase I ) and future
extension from France Avenue to Glenwood Parkway (Phase II ) . The report
will include estimated costs , locations , etc . for the extension .
Richard Craves arrived at this time .
In addition it was requested that the report include recommendations for
"NO Right Turn " off Highway 100 (northbound ) at West 16th Street with
Possible curvilinear designed streets that match the old Cedar Lake
Road for traffic control purposes .
It was indicated that hopefully the staff work and meeting can be held
Within 30 days and a tentative meeting was set for Tuesday , October 19th .

4 . A brief discussion was held regarding the Bassetts Creek Watershed
District , its past and future and it was decided that no action could
be taken by the Council at this time regarding the subject .
